Helios Technologies HLIO Business Segments
| FY'25 | FY'24 | FY'23 | FY'22 | ||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Revenue by Business | |||||
| Electronics | $298.3M+11.0% | $268.7M-0.4% | $269.8M-19.2% | $334.1M-5.3% | |
| Hydraulics | $540.8M+0.7% | $537.2M-5.1% | $565.8M+2.6% | $551.3M+6.8% | |
| Unallocated Expenses | $0— | $0— | $0— | $0— | |
| Gross Profit by Business | |||||
| Electronics | $96.5M+11.6% | $86.5M+8.3% | $79.9M-22.4% | $103M— | |
| Hydraulics | $174.8M+5.4% | $165.8M-8.8% | $181.8M-7.0% | $195.5M— | |
| Unallocated Expenses | $0— | $0— | $0— | $0— | |
| Operating Income by Business | |||||
| Electronics | $9.7M-67.2% | $29.6M+20.3% | $24.6M-53.1% | $52.5M-26.8% | |
| Hydraulics | $91.3M+5.7% | $86.4M-7.5% | $93.4M-23.9% | $122.7M+2.4% | |
